Topic:Intra-Articular Injection

Intra-articular injection in horses involves the administration of therapeutic agents directly into a joint space. This technique is used to manage joint diseases, such as osteoarthritis, by delivering medications like corticosteroids, hyaluronic acid, or biologic therapies directly to the affected area. The procedure aims to reduce inflammation, alleviate pain, and improve joint function. Intra-articular injections are commonly performed under sterile conditions to minimize the risk of infection. Treatment of sepsis in the small tarsal joints of 11 horses with gentamicin-impregnated polymethylmethacrylate beads.
The Veterinary record    April 26, 2001   Volume 148, Issue 12 376-380 doi: 10.1136/vr.148.12.376
Booth TM, Butson RJ, Clegg PD, Schramme MC, Smith RK.Gentamicin-impregnated polymethylmethacrylate beads were used to treat infective arthritis in the small tarsal joints of 11 severely lame horses. Under general anaesthesia, between five and 10 beads were placed into a 7 to 8 mm tract drilled across the affected joint and, in all except one horse, they were left in place for 14 days. Two of the horses were euthanased for reasons other than persistent tarsal joint sepsis, but the other nine survived and seven of them returned to their previous level of athletic performance.

Treatment of progressive ethmoidal haematoma using intralesional injections of formalin in three horses.
Australian veterinary journal    May 17, 2000   Volume 77, Issue 6 371-373 doi: 10.1111/j.1751-0813.1999.tb10306.x
Marriott MR, Dart AJ, Hodgson DR.Three Thoroughbred horses with unilateral progressive ethmoid haematomas were treated using intralesional injections of 10% formalin (4% formaldehyde solution). Injections were performed in the standing sedated horse through the nasal passages under endoscopic guidance and, when the ethmoid haematoma involved the paranasal sinuses, through holes trephined into the affected sinus. Regression of the lesions occurred in all cases after repeated injections. This technique appears to be a safe and effective treatment for progressive ethmoid haematomas in the horse.
